Full source
import { setMainLoopModelOverride } from '../bootstrap/state.js'
import {
clearApiKeyHelperCache,
clearAwsCredentialsCache,
clearGcpCredentialsCache,
} from '../utils/auth.js'
import { getGlobalConfig, saveGlobalConfig } from '../utils/config.js'
import { toError } from '../utils/errors.js'
import { logError } from '../utils/log.js'
import { applyConfigEnvironmentVariables } from '../utils/managedEnv.js'
import {
permissionModeFromString,
toExternalPermissionMode,
} from '../utils/permissions/PermissionMode.js'
import {
notifyPermissionModeChanged,
notifySessionMetadataChanged,
type SessionExternalMetadata,
} from '../utils/sessionState.js'
import { updateSettingsForSource } from '../utils/settings/settings.js'
import type { AppState } from './AppStateStore.js'
// Inverse of the push below — restore on worker restart.
export function externalMetadataToAppState(
metadata: SessionExternalMetadata,
): (prev: AppState) => AppState {
return prev => ({
...prev,
...(typeof metadata.permission_mode === 'string'
? {
toolPermissionContext: {
...prev.toolPermissionContext,
mode: permissionModeFromString(metadata.permission_mode),
},
}
: {}),
...(typeof metadata.is_ultraplan_mode === 'boolean'
? { isUltraplanMode: metadata.is_ultraplan_mode }
: {}),
})
}
export function onChangeAppState({
newState,
oldState,
}: {
newState: AppState
oldState: AppState
}) {
// toolPermissionContext.mode — single choke point for CCR/SDK mode sync.
//
// Prior to this block, mode changes were relayed to CCR by only 2 of 8+
// mutation paths: a bespoke setAppState wrapper in print.ts (headless/SDK
// mode only) and a manual notify in the set_permission_mode handler.
// Every other path — Shift+Tab cycling, ExitPlanModePermissionRequest
// dialog options, the /plan slash command, rewind, the REPL bridge's
// onSetPermissionMode — mutated AppState without telling
// CCR, leaving external_metadata.permission_mode stale and the web UI out
// of sync with the CLI's actual mode.
//
// Hooking the diff here means ANY setAppState call that changes the mode
// notifies CCR (via notifySessionMetadataChanged → ccrClient.reportMetadata)
// and the SDK status stream (via notifyPermissionModeChanged → registered
// in print.ts). The scattered callsites above need zero changes.
const prevMode = oldState.toolPermissionContext.mode
const newMode = newState.toolPermissionContext.mode
if (prevMode !== newMode) {
// CCR external_metadata must not receive internal-only mode names
// (bubble, ungated auto). Externalize first — and skip
// the CCR notify if the EXTERNAL mode didn't change (e.g.,
// default→bubble→default is noise from CCR's POV since both
// externalize to 'default'). The SDK channel (notifyPermissionModeChanged)
// passes raw mode; its listener in print.ts applies its own filter.
const prevExternal = toExternalPermissionMode(prevMode)
const newExternal = toExternalPermissionMode(newMode)
if (prevExternal !== newExternal) {
// Ultraplan = first plan cycle only. The initial control_request
// sets mode and isUltraplanMode atomically, so the flag's
// transition gates it. null per RFC 7396 (removes the key).
const isUltraplan =
newExternal === 'plan' &&
newState.isUltraplanMode &&
!oldState.isUltraplanMode
? true
: null
notifySessionMetadataChanged({
permission_mode: newExternal,
is_ultraplan_mode: isUltraplan,
})
}
notifyPermissionModeChanged(newMode)
}
// mainLoopModel: remove it from settings?
if (
newState.mainLoopModel !== oldState.mainLoopModel &&
newState.mainLoopModel === null
) {
// Remove from settings
updateSettingsForSource('userSettings', { model: undefined })
setMainLoopModelOverride(null)
}
// mainLoopModel: add it to settings?
if (
newState.mainLoopModel !== oldState.mainLoopModel &&
newState.mainLoopModel !== null
) {
// Save to settings
updateSettingsForSource('userSettings', { model: newState.mainLoopModel })
setMainLoopModelOverride(newState.mainLoopModel)
}
// expandedView → persist as showExpandedTodos + showSpinnerTree for backwards compat
if (newState.expandedView !== oldState.expandedView) {
const showExpandedTodos = newState.expandedView === 'tasks'
const showSpinnerTree = newState.expandedView === 'teammates'
if (
getGlobalConfig().showExpandedTodos !== showExpandedTodos ||
getGlobalConfig().showSpinnerTree !== showSpinnerTree
) {
saveGlobalConfig(current => ({
...current,
showExpandedTodos,
showSpinnerTree,
}))
}
}
// verbose
if (
newState.verbose !== oldState.verbose &&
getGlobalConfig().verbose !== newState.verbose
) {
const verbose = newState.verbose
saveGlobalConfig(current => ({
...current,
verbose,
}))
}
// tungstenPanelVisible (ant-only tmux panel sticky toggle)
if (process.env.USER_TYPE === 'ant') {
if (
newState.tungstenPanelVisible !== oldState.tungstenPanelVisible &&
newState.tungstenPanelVisible !== undefined &&
getGlobalConfig().tungstenPanelVisible !== newState.tungstenPanelVisible
) {
const tungstenPanelVisible = newState.tungstenPanelVisible
saveGlobalConfig(current => ({ ...current, tungstenPanelVisible }))
}
}
// settings: clear auth-related caches when settings change
// This ensures apiKeyHelper and AWS/GCP credential changes take effect immediately
if (newState.settings !== oldState.settings) {
try {
clearApiKeyHelperCache()
clearAwsCredentialsCache()
clearGcpCredentialsCache()
// Re-apply environment variables when settings.env changes
// This is additive-only: new vars are added, existing may be overwritten, nothing is deleted
if (newState.settings.env !== oldState.settings.env) {
applyConfigEnvironmentVariables()
}
} catch (error) {
logError(toError(error))
}
}
}
